Thames Homers, Drives in Two, in 7-2 Loss to Baysox

Published on May 23, 2010 under Eastern League (EL1)
New Hampshire Fisher Cats News Release


Bowie, MD- Eric Thames hit a solo home run and an RBI single, and Zach Stewart turned in his second straight quality start by allowing two runs on five hits in six innings, but Pedro Florimon's eighth-inning grand slam helped the Bowie Baysox knock off the New Hampshire Fisher Cats, 7-2, on Sunday afternoon at Prince George's Stadium.

Leading 3-2 with two outs and the bases loaded in the bottom of the eighth, Florimon (1-for-3, GS, SAC, 4 RBI) took Tim Collins over the left field wall for his first home run of the season. Three of the runs were charged to losing pitcher Vince Bongiovanni (4-1), who saw his nine-outing scoreless streak snapped after yielding four runs on four hits and two walks in one-plus inning, with one strikeout, to suffer his first loss.

Pat Egan (4-1) earned the win with two shutout innings of relief, scattering two hits.

Pedro Beato pitched a scoreless ninth, as Bowie (21-22) took two out of the three games from the first-place Fisher Cats (26-16) in the series.

Steve Lerud (1-for-3, HR, HBP) staked Bowie to a 1-0 lead in the bottom of the second when he connected on Stewart's 3-1 pitch for a tape-measure homer to right, his first.

The Fisher Cats countered in the top of the fourth when Thames (2-for-4, HR, 2 RBI) launched Chorye Spoone's first pitch of the inning over the right field fence for his eighth home run of the season, tying the game 1-1.

Thames gave New Hampshire the lead in the top of the fifth with a two-out ground single to right, plating Luis Sanchez (1-for-3, R) for a 2-1 advantage.

Spoone worked six innings, allowing two runs on four hits, with two walks and three strikeouts in a no-decision.

The Baysox again squared the game, 2-2, courtesy of Brandon Waring's sixth homer of the year, a two-out solo blast in the bottom of the sixth off Stewart.

Bowie grabbed the lead for good in the bottom of the seventh. Facing Bongiovanni, Carlos Rojas (2-for-5, RBI) drove in Matt Angle (2-for-4, BB, R) with a two-out RBI single to right for a 3-2 lead.
